Someone has laid claim to the planet of Eternia. Per Fundamental Force rules, a Traitor Game is used to settle the issue of ownership. So, people get ripped out of their dimensions to be brutally slain, natch. From Doc Orpheus' base to a beach in Mexico, players... sit and talk. And kill each other.
